📜  jQueryUI 手风琴禁用选项(1)

📅  最后修改于: 2023-12-03 15:16:50.585000             🧑  作者: Mango

jQueryUI 手风琴禁用选项

介绍

jQueryUI 是一个流行的 JavaScript 库,提供了许多实用的 UI 组件。其中之一是手风琴(Accordion),允许用户在点击不同的标题时展开或折叠列表项。

有时候,我们可能需要禁用手风琴中的某些选项,使其在用户点击时不会有任何响应。这就需要用到 jQueryUI 手风琴的禁用选项。

如何禁用选项

要禁用 jQueryUI 手风琴中的选项,可以使用 disable 方法。该方法需要传入一个参数,即要禁用的选项的索引。例如,要禁用第二个选项,可以使用以下代码:

$("#accordion").accordion("disable", 1);

在这个代码片段中,$("#accordion") 选择了手风琴的容器,并调用了 accordion 方法初始化手风琴。disable 方法被调用后,第二个选项将被禁用。

如何启用选项

除了禁用选项,还可以使用 enable 方法来启用被禁用的选项。该方法的使用方式与 disable 方法类似,只需要将参数改为要启用的选项的索引即可:

$("#accordion").accordion("enable", 1);
注意事项

需要注意的是,如果手风琴中只有两个选项,那么第二个选项被禁用后,手风琴将无法正常工作。因此,在禁用前需先检查手风琴中选项的个数,以确保不会出现类似的问题。

结论

通过使用 jQueryUI 手风琴的禁用选项,我们可以很容易地实现手风琴中的选项禁用和启用。这可以为用户提供更好的体验,并减少不必要的交互。